Canada’s Premiers Announce 2016 Literacy Award Recipients

Canada’s Premiers today announced the recipients of the 12th annual Council of the Federation Literacy Award in honour of International Literacy Day. The award is presented to recipients from all 13 provinces and territories to celebrate outstanding achievement, innovative practice, and excellence in literacy.
